Dolby Digital & Home Theater System (S/PDIF Port)
This product supports 5.1 channel output, which is a basic function for home theater
systems and DVD drives. It provides 3D surround sound and a vivid screen.
Home theater system usually consists of a TV, DVD, 5.1 channel speakers,
and a digital amplifier to provide a high-resolution vivid (MPEG2) picture and
3D surround sound (Dolby 5.1 or DTS). With a home theater system, you can
enjoy the same vivid picture and sound in your home that you would in a movie
theater.
You will need the following to enjoy a home theater system:
5.1 channel speaker system / Digital amplifier (Purchased separately).
DVD drive and DVD Program (Option).
S/PDIF cable (Option)
Setting Up Your Home Theater
1. Connect the digital amplifier to the S/PDIF port of your computer.
